<p>A gait problem may lie with other structures of the body and a thorough, skillful assessment of your biomechanics, including foot, lower limb and spine is our standard approach.  For this reason, we prefer to use the term biomechanical assessment, of which gait analysis is only an element.</p>
<p>The outcome of the assessment will let us know where the problem lies. This will open up various treatment pathways, adapting them to find the right combination for you.</p>
<ul>
<li>Some problems can be rectified with manipulation, adjustment and exercise programmes.</li>
<li>Core strength training can improve posture, leading to a more efficient gait (walking pattern).</li>
<li>Orthotics and specific exercises can be used to correct problems with the foot itself.</li>

<p><strong>What conditions can be treated?</strong></p>
<p>You do not need to have a sports injury or joint problem to benefit from our treatments.  Some of the soft tissue techniques are excellent for alleviating the symptoms of Fibromyalgia or Chronic Fatigue Syndrome, whilst the specialised technique of Lymphatic Drainage Massage is very helpful to those who have had lymph glands removed or damaged due to surgery.<strong><br /></strong></p>
<ul>
<li>Sports and soft tissue injuries</li>
<li>Rehabilitation following fractures or surgery</li>
<li>Back and neck pain, spinal disc problems and sciatica</li>
<li>Joint, muscle and ligament problems</li>
<li>Knee and shoulder conditions</li>
<li>Temporomandibular Joint Dysfunction / Syndrome (TMD).</li>
<li>Repetitive strain &amp; overuse injuries</li>
<li>Migraine and headaches</li>
<li>Stress / tension</li>
<li>Fibromyalgia, chronic fatigue syndrome and MS</li>
<li>Menopause symptoms</li>
<li>Postural dysfunction</li>
<li>Nerve pain</li>
</ul>

<p><strong>The Foot Problem</strong><br />
As we walk, the foot strikes the ground slightly on the outer side of the heel.  Natural forces encourage the foot to roll inward slightly (pronate) before lifting off using the big toe as a lever. In effect, your foot acts like a spring.</p>
<p>In some feet, this leaning inward (pronation) of the midfoot and heel is excessive and causes strain to the joints and supporting ligaments of the foot.  Painful symptoms in the foot, lower leg and knee may develop with some of the worst cases causing pain in the lower back and loss of core stability. The &#8220;spring&#8221; effect of the foot is lost.</p>
<p>To prevent this from happening, the heel should remain vertical, the medial arch supported and pressure distributed evenly through the forefoot.</p>
<p>Of course, there are people who place too much pressure on the outside of the foot (Supination).  Although this is not as common, it can also cause foot pain and symptoms such as shin splints.</p>
<p>Many conditions such as heel pain, Metatarsalgia (pain under the toe joints) and Plantar Fasciitis are a sign that something may be wrong with the biomechanics of the foot.</p>
<p><a title="gait analysis" href="http://www.thesportsphysio.com/contents1a/about/orthotics-and-gait-analysis/" target="_blank"><strong>The Solution</strong></a><br />
Sometimes the problem does not lie with the foot itself, so skillful analysis of your biomechanics, including foot, lower limb and back assessment is carried out.</p>
<p>Manipulation, adjustment and exercise programmes can help to rectify problems with the back or lower limb.</p>
<p>Core strength training can alter posture, leading to a more efficient gait (walking pattern).</p>
<p>Orthotics and specific exercises can be used to correct problems with the foot itself.</p>
